Oracle Database Administrator at a financial services firm with 501-1,000 employees3.5I found HPE Integrity secure and highly fault-tolerant for mission-critical banking needs, meeting most compliance requirements, but it felt inflexible and proprietary with dated backup/VM features and harder Oracle support, so we’re migrating on‑prem to Dell/Linux via a third party.
Head of IT Operations at NCC BANK LIMITED4.0I found this HPE server reliable with easy setup and good customer service, despite an initial mezzanine card issue I resolved. My main concern is its very high pricing compared to competitors.

Unix System Engineer at Road Accident Fund4.0I find HPE Integrity servers stable and easy to manage, but the slow development of the operating system hampers integration with modern tech and clouds like Office 365. I believe Linux would be a more adaptable and cost-effective alternative.
Oracle Database Administrator at a financial services firm with 501-1,000 employees3.5HPE Integrity needs improvement in virtualization, cloud enablement, backup, and replication speed. It should enhance disaster recovery readiness and its technical support response time. Faster server provisioning and improved snapshot technology are desired for better system efficiency.

DGM at Bharat Electronics Limited4.0I've used HPE Integrity for nine years for mission-critical SAP, valuing its stability and scalability. Setup was straightforward, and support is excellent. Virtualization could be simplified. I recommend it, rating it eight out of ten.
General Manager at EGPC4.5I find HPE Integrity fast, easy to use, and stable, making it ideal for medium companies. The setup was simple, and the price is reasonable. However, the monitoring features could be improved.
